Bad programmers worry about the code. Good programmers worry about data structures and their relationships
среди успешных людей я не встречала нытиков
Барбара Коркоран
Вам, конечно далеко, т.к вы не в состоянии членораздельно описать симптомы неисправности, какие светодиоды горят, прочитать инструкцию на прибор это вообще труд неподъемный. Зато мы диагнозы ставим и делаем выводы космического масштаба и космической же глупости.
И, так для справки, если прибор ломается что делает нормальный человек? Правильно, обращается к поставщику, т.е тому, кто его поставил в составе установки и программу писал.
коллеги будьте внимательны! я прошу помощи...
1. подключился через Debug RS232 показывает ошибку ядра.
2. обновил прошивку - ошибка ядра пропала, теперь ошибка памяти
итак в продолжении истории с больным...
возможно вылечился
1. Прошивка последней версии ядра, через bat файл не приводила к успеху - после перезапуска ошибка DDR
каждый раз адрес(код ошибки) разный.
2. Прошил версию po_factorypacket_plc110_m02__bat_v0.3.53 старт прошел спешно - ошибок нет
IP ПЛК установился 10.2.11.119, сеть поднялась - пинг идет, поменял IP, записал программу пользователя - запустилась, но панель оператора получает некорректные данные - ясно таргет файл другой.
3. Прошил снова последнюю версию ядра - опять ошибка как в п1.
4. В описании процедуры прошивки для первой версии ядра наткнулся на информацию о типе флешки, которую надо указать в bat файле.
В последующих описаниях такое инф не находил, есть информация только о смене номера ком порта. В директории с прошивкой есть несколько файлов с названиями флеш. Моей флеш в списке не оказалось. По умолчанию прошивается тип флеш ubl_AM1808_NAND_UNIVERSAL.
sfh_OMAP-L138.exe -p "COM3" -flashtype NAND -flash -appStartAddr 0xC0000000 -appLoadAddr 0xC0000000 ubl_AM1808_NAND_UNIVERSAL.bin 110_30_v1.2.42.bin
в итоге ПЛК не стартует.
5. прошил ПЛК с указанием типа флеш ubl_AM1808_NAND_ISSI_133MGz.
ПЛК перезапустился, появился в сети, залил пользовательскую программу. Третий час полёт нормальный.
После выключения/включения питания ПЛК запускается. Только один раз пришлось нажать ресет.
sfh_OMAP-L138.exe -p "COM3" -flashtype NAND -flash -appStartAddr 0xC0000000 -appLoadAddr 0xC0000000 ubl_AM1808_NAND_ISSI_133MGz.bin 110_30_ v1.2.42.bin
6. Будем считать что заработал. Время покажет как долго будет работать. Возможно умирает флеш и не работает при 150МГц.
7. Спасибо большое.
Последний раз редактировалось Васильев; 13.07.2024 в 17:19.
Еще один контроллер спасен по данной методике.
Лучше бы подробно описали, что и как делали. Флешки разные у всех.
Инструкцию Васильева, только он сам поймёт.
Сначала лил один файл, потом другой, а потом он же не тот, таргет другой, надо вот этот, какой ХЗ.
https://owen.ru/forum/showthread.php...l=1#post441512
Последний раз редактировалось kondor3000; 13.10.2025 в 22:04.
вот ещё один безнадежный пациент (симптомы один в один)- ожил!
осталось только объснить что же именно было с плк и/или его памятью
каким образом с "кремния" исчезает информация, которую надо потом насильственно запихивать обратно
думаю, это объяснение тянет на Нобелевку